Job Summary

Job Summary:

TheCampus Safety Office at Rollins College is currently inviting service-oriented individuals to apply for two full-time Security Officer positions. As a Security Officer you will play a vital role in maintaining a safe and welcoming campus environment for our students faculty staff and visitors. This is a great opportunity to be part of a team that values professionalism community engagement and proactive safety services.

  • Advising directing and providing information to students employees and the public
  • Patrolling the campus on foot or motor vehicle to ensure the protection of all campus faculty staff students and visitors as well as securing all campus buildings structures and property (Areas include buildings grounds parking lot adjacent streets and off-campus properties)
  • Responding to all accidents crimes and complaints calls occurring on campus property
  • Assisting motorists students employees and visitors on campus answering calls for assistance escorting students and others as requested
  • Noting and taking preventative/corrective action on all hazards and areas of concern
  • Review and respond to emails and phone calls promptly
  • Preparing and maintaining necessary campus security records and reports
  • Making preliminary investigative reports and collecting initial information for Campus Safety Incident Reports
  • Enforcing traffic and parking regulations
  • Providing safety security services for large gatherings and events on campus
  • Administering first aid as necessary and calling for emergency medical services
  • Assisting in the implementation of safety/security programs for faculty staff and students
  • Assisting in the monitoring of computerized security systems
  • Coordinating and working closely with local police and fire departments
  • Opening and closing facilities; monitoring and controlling access to building and restricted area
  • Monitoring alarm systems and responding when necessary
  • Inspecting buildings for security fire and other potential hazards

Minimum
Qualifications & Education:

  • High school diploma or equivalent is required.
  • At least two years of job-related experience is required.
  • Valid Florida drivers license and acceptable motor vehicle report (MVR) are required to drive College vehicles.
  • Possess and maintain CPR and First Aid certification within 90 days of hire.
  • Possess and maintain State of Florida Class D security license within 90 days of hire.

Knowledge Skills & Abilities:

  • Ability to train direct and supervise the work of others
  • Demonstrated knowledge of modern safety/police practices and procedures
  • Knowledge of and abiding by all guidelines associated with the Clery Act and Title IX
  • Strong service orientation with a demonstrated ability to effectively meet the needs of and work collaboratively with a diverse population of students staff faculty and public
  • Ability to use tact and good judgment in resolving work problems and dealing with the public students and staff
  • Ability to work in demanding and stressful situations

Work Schedule:

The Campus Safety Office provides 24-hour response to call for service provides routine and directed patrol activities parking enforcement and preliminary investigation of most campus incidents.

  • Schedule:
    • 2nd Shift: 3:00 PM 11:00 PM (Tuesdays & Wednesdays off)
    • 3rd Shift: 11:00 PM 7:00 AM (Fridays & Saturdays off)
  • Hours: Security Officers work approximately 40 hours per week for a total of 2080 hours per year.

Working Environment:

  • Front-facing customer service role on-campus (inside and outside).
  • Work requires exposure to potentially dangerous situation requires physical strain involving walking and standing for extended periods of time (must be able to run short distance walk a flight of stairs lift up to 50 pounds) and exposure to the elements.
  • As a condition of employment in this position the incumbent will be subject to call-in outside of regular hours in order to respond to emergencies including the preparation and maintenance of college facilities grounds systems and services during inclement weather crises.
  • Able to work flexible hours; overtime may be required.
